Parkinson's disease - Analyzing drug discovery targets using paper search AI

In drug discovery research, it is essential to check daily paper information and public databases, and update knowledge and knowledge of important information.However, the number of documents is increasing year by year, and it is already difficult for humans to cover all the necessary information.
The article search AI "KIBIT Amanogawa" can instantly detect and analyze article information with high similarity and relevance from the huge amount of article information of over 3000 million articles published on Pubmed.
It makes it possible to find information that could not be found through conventional keyword searches and information that is not biased by the searcher, realizing objective and comprehensive analysis in medical and drug discovery research.
